Just when you thought things were starting to simmer down in Cotton Creek, something new crops up. And this time the attention is on the Sweet gals. Hannah may have found her dream guy in Cooper Quinlan, and she's damned determined to plan the perfect wedding - no matter who she drives crazy. Everything would be perfect if she could just ignore the little bursts of excitement she gets every time she sees Bryson Weathers.

Cody isn't being much help. She doesn't give a hoot in hell about fancy dresses and weddings. What she does care about is the clandestine relationship she has with Jaxon Riggs. He's made no bones about the fact that he isn't looking for forever. She is, but if it's not in the cards, then so be it. Riggs trips her switch and she's not about to pass up one moment with him, nor is she about to let anything prevent her from being with him.

That resolve was holding pretty firm until an old friend, Belinda, shows up with a three-year-old daughter, Bernice, in tow. Belinda is sick. If she doesn't get a kidney transplant she'll die. And she wants Cody to commit to being Bernice's godmother, to raise her if Belinda dies.

It's a tall order, but Cody falls in love with the little girl and is ready to say yes. Then all hell breaks loose when Belinda says that Bernice's father is right there in Cotton Creek. If it's true, it's going to cause a whole lot of trouble.

Come share the joys and woes, the danger and the fun as we prove once more that the old saying "nothing ever happens in Cotton Creek" needs to be changed to, "Looking for trouble? You've come to the right place."

Jumpin’ Jehosephat! Where to start? The Sweet girls have got it going on in this one and the book is definitely aptly titled.

Hannah Sweet has dreamed about and planned her wedding from the time she was a little girl, and she’s found the man who can afford, and is willing to give it to her, Cooper Quinlan. The only problem is, whenever she is around Bryson Weathers, she gets little shivers running up and down her spine.

Cody Sweet is resigned to the fact that she will probably be the town spinster and will never have a family of her own. Her goal is to enjoy her life to the fullest which, right now, means having a fling with Jaxon Riggs. Jaxon is quite a bit older than Cody and has made it clear that he is not interested in anything serious, or even sticking around Cotton Creek. Cody is OK with that, but deep down has hopes of changing his mind.

Life is good, until Belinda, an old high school friend of Cody’s shows up in Cotton Creek with a tale of woe and a three year old daughter in tow, looking for Cody’s help. From that point on chaos reigns in Cotton Creek and none of their lives will ever be the same again.

This was my favorite book of this series, and J. Scott Bennett’s narration is partially responsible for that. He has the uncanny ability to become the characters he’s reading, which is truly a gift. The story itself starts off with a first chapter that will take your breath away and have you swooning. It never slows down from that first chapter on, and will trigger every emotion you have. Cliché but true, I laughed, I held my breath, I cried, and swooned, not necessarily in that order. I felt every one of those emotions over and over throughout the book. Grab some tissues and read this book!
